Qiao Ziman pushed open the door and stormed out, her small high heels clicking loudly as they nearly flew off her feet. Chi Yin followed behind, calm and composed, occasionally brushing her fingers over her slightly reddened lips, savoring the taste of the recent kiss.
“Good afternoon, Qiao Jie,” a coworker greeted.
“Good afternoon, President Chi,” another added.
“Qiao Jie, what happened to your lips?”
Qiao Ziman froze mid-step, her body stiffening. She threw an accusing glare at Chi Yin, her eyes filled with resentment. “Hurry up!”
Chi Yin stifled a laugh and quickly caught up to her. “Alright.”
The two walked out of the company side by side. Their colleagues, watching from behind, couldn’t help but huddle together and whisper.
“Have you noticed something off between those two lately?”
“Yeah, they come to work and leave together every day. I even saw them coming out of the same apartment complex once. Pretty sure they were holding hands…”
“Exactly! Qiao Jie is always running to President Chi’s office, and sometimes the door gets locked. Does an assistant really need to lock the door?”
“Qiao Jie’s lips… do you think President Chi kissed her?”
“I just saw Qiao Jie’s ears turn red, and why was President Chi smiling at her so fondly?”
“Alright, alright, stop gossiping. Remember what happened to Lu Yu and the others last time they spread rumors…” someone warned.
At that reminder, the gossiping group quickly scattered. But though the chatter stopped, a seed of suspicion had been planted in some hearts.
After leaving the office, Qiao Ziman and Chi Yin drove to the city’s most popular Sichuan restaurant. Qiao Ziman, still fuming, plopped down in the private room with a huff. She shot a sideways glance at Chi Yin. “You’re not allowed to eat anything spicy later!” she declared, turning her head toward the door to avoid looking at her.
Chi Yin, calm and unbothered, carefully sterilized the tableware with hot water and placed it in front of Qiao Ziman. “Whatever you say, Teacher,” she replied with a soft smile.
Teacher, teacher, teacher… Qiao Ziman thought, her smirk growing. She was kissing me so fiercely earlier, and now she suddenly remembers I’m her teacher?
Just then, the phone on the table vibrated. Chi Yin glanced at the screen and said to Qiao Ziman, who was still sulking, “Shi Qiansui is at the door.”
Qiao Ziman immediately jumped up, her expression turning serious, her hands clenching tightly. Chi Yin gently took her hand and squeezed her palm, her touch warm and reassuring. “Relax, I’ve got this.”
Her words were like a calming pill, instantly easing Qiao Ziman’s tension and anxiety.
“Okay,” Qiao Ziman nodded.
The two of them went out to greet their guest. From a distance, they saw two girls approaching.
The one walking in front had a chic princess-cut hairstyle, half of her face obscured by oversized sunglasses, giving her an air of aloofness. She wore a crop top and ultra-short shorts, her pale skin practically glowing. With each step her long legs took, her presence was undeniable.
That must be Shi Qiansui.
The girl walking behind her was tall and stoic, following a meter behind at all times. A bodyguard?
Qiao Ziman squeezed Chi Yin’s hand again and whispered, “Are all web novel authors this flashy nowadays? Look at her—now that’s someone who knows the real world.”
“I don’t know about you, but this feels like I’ve walked straight into some high-society novel about a wealthy heiress,” Qiao Ziman muttered, half-jokingly.
Chi Yin couldn’t hold back a chuckle.
Shi Qiansui approached them and stopped in front, her bright eyes peeking out from beneath her sunglasses. She scrutinized them carefully for a moment before finally speaking.
“Dashun.”
The girl behind Shi Qiansui responded in a low voice, “Here, Qiansui-jie,” and, without needing further instruction, stepped forward to open the private room door for her. Once her task was complete, she quietly returned to her position a meter behind Shi Qiansui.
Without paying much attention to the two women, Shi Qiansui strode confidently into the room. Qiao Ziman, still nervous, followed closely behind. The door creaked shut behind them with a soft click.
Inside, Shi Qiansui collapsed onto the chair, twisting herself into an oddly relaxed, pretzel-like shape. She pushed her sunglasses down to reveal a stunning face, radiating charm. When she smiled, two small tiger teeth peeked out.
“Aiyaya, I’m dying here! It’s all my dad’s fault—he insisted I keep my mouth shut and act like some proper lady from a prestigious family. Just because he won a lottery and made a billion flipping land deals, suddenly he thinks we’re aristocrats. Really, can we even claim to be high society?” Shi Qiansui exclaimed, then quickly added, “Oh, right, I should introduce myself. I’m Shi Qiansui, and I have a sister named Shi Qianjin.”
Qiao Ziman: “…” Well, now I get why they told her to keep quiet—she’d reveal all the family secrets if she kept talking.
From behind her, Dashun timely interjected, “Qiansui-jie.”
Shi Qiansui immediately clammed up, sitting up straight. “Ah, sorry, sorry.” She blinked her big, lively eyes and flashed a bright smile. “Wow, two beautiful ladies here! You’re both stunning. Do I have your contact info? How about we add each other on WeChat?”
Dashun chimed in again, “Qiansui-jie.”
Shi Qiansui quickly shoved her phone back into her pocket. “Ahem, never mind, we won’t add WeChat. After all, I have a girlfriend, so I need to maintain some distance from other women and give her enough security.”
Then, turning to Dashun, she asked, “I’m definitely not under my girlfriend’s thumb, right, Dashun?”
Dashun replied in a flat tone, “Right.”
Qiao Ziman: “…” No wonder she’s so hard to get a hold of.
Unable to resist, Qiao Ziman asked, “But do you really need to keep your distance from others just because you have a girlfriend?”
“Of course!” Shi Qiansui replied enthusiastically. “By the way, what’s your name, beautiful?”
“Qiao Ziman,” she replied, regaining her composure.
Shi Qiansui pointed at Chi Yin. “President Chi mentioned you before. You’re the project lead and the art director, right?”
Qiao Ziman straightened up, now fully serious. “Yes, that’s right.”
“I wanted to meet with you today to ask your thoughts on the game adaptation of Master White Fox,” Qiao Ziman explained.
Shi Qiansui waved her hand dismissively, clearly annoyed. “Please don’t be so formal with the ‘you’ this, ‘you’ that. It feels weird—just call me Qiansui.”
She leaned back in her chair, appearing completely at ease. “As for the project, I have no real opinions. Go ahead and use your creativity. My girlfriend, Yanyan, says that for creators, the desire to express oneself and follow inspiration is the most important thing. You shouldn’t be restricted—follow your heart.”
“Oh, by the way, Yanyan is my girlfriend. Isn’t she amazing?” Shi Qiansui added with a blink, clearly expecting some praise.
Qiao Ziman: “…” Alright then.
“She’s amazing,” Qiao Ziman finally said.
Shi Qiansui beamed. “To answer your previous question, of course you have to keep your distance from others when you have a girlfriend. Can you really stand seeing your girlfriend get upset or cry because of you?”
As soon as Shi Qiansui mentioned girlfriend, the image of Chi Yin immediately popped into Qiao Ziman’s mind. Would I make my little white flower upset? Make her cry? No way. The thought alone made her heart ache.
“I’ve learned something important,” Qiao Ziman said earnestly.
Learned what? Chi Yin set her cup down with a little more force than necessary, her voice noticeably cooler. “Let’s order, shall we?”
Qiao Ziman squinted at the menu, her irritation bubbling up. “Why is everything spicy? Didn’t I tell you to order a couple of lighter dishes? Did you just ignore me?”
Snatching the menu, she carefully selected a few dishes and marked off stir-fried mushrooms and bamboo shoots. “Braised pork ribs sound good, too. You’ve been looking a bit thin lately. Can you eat a bit more?” She added a soup to the order as well, her tone softening slightly.
Shi Qiansui glanced back and forth between the two, clearly observing the dynamic with keen interest.
Suddenly, Shi Qiansui slapped the table with excitement, her voice ringing out, “Are you two a couple?”
Qiao Ziman froze, the pen in her hand pausing mid-air. Her heart raced, unsure of how to respond to the unexpected question.
Before she could stammer out a reply, Chi Yin stepped in smoothly, her tone calm but firm. “For now, she’s my teacher.”
